I am having some difficulties installing the Linux bkupexec agent.

Everything seems to go alright but when i want to start the agent.be it comes with:

-bash: ./agent.be: No such file or directory

You need to install the "ia32-libs" package if you are using a 64bit OS.

After this the agent will start!
